Designs e Designer designs-and-the-designer
O Designer é usado para criar um design para seu site usando o Interface clássica em AEM.
Uso do Designer using-the-designer
Seu design pode ser definido na variável designs da seção Ferramentas guia :
Aqui, você pode criar a estrutura necessária para armazenar o design e, em seguida, fazer upload das folhas de estilos em cascata e imagens necessárias.
Designs são armazenados em /apps/<your-project>. O caminho para o design a ser usado para um site é especificado usando o cq:designPath da jcr:content nó .
O que você precisará what-you-will-need
Para realizar seu design, você precisará:
CSS - As folhas de estilos em cascata definem os formatos de áreas específicas nas páginas.
Imagens - Qualquer imagem usada para recursos como planos de fundo, botões.
Considerações ao criar seu site considerations-when-designing-your-website
Ao desenvolver um site, é altamente recomendável armazenar imagens e arquivos CSS em /apps/<your-project> assim, você pode fazer referência aos seus recursos com base no design atual, como descrito pelo seguinte trecho.
<%= currentDesign.getPath() + "/static/img/icon.gif %>
O exemplo anterior oferece vários benefícios:
-
Os componentes podem ter uma aparência diferente com base em cada site usando um caminho de design diferente.
-
A reformulação do site pode ser feita simplesmente apontando o caminho do design para um nó diferente na raiz do site
design/v1paradesign/v2. -
/etc/designse/contentsão as únicas URLs externas que o navegador vê, protegendo você de um usuário externo ficando curioso sobre o que está em seu/appsárvore. Os benefícios do URL acima também ajudam o Administrador do sistema a configurar melhor segurança, pois você está limitando a exposição dos ativos a alguns locais distintos.